The first step to selling on eBay is to register with the site. It is absolutely free and you are opening yourself up to a huge online community of which you can buy and sell almost anything! Once you sign up, there are links at the top of the homepage that you can use to navigate your way around.
Next, you must decide what you want to sell. Look around your house. In the garage. In the kids' rooms. In your colset. There may be many odds and ends lying around your home that someone else may be willing to buy. That old antique vase in the garage may become an antique masterpiece to someone else! You will then need to write up a full, truthful description of the item or items chosen. Be sure to add as much detail as possible, including brand name, color, size, material, height, weight, and whether it is new or used. Take photographs and be sure to note all of the details and defects that the item may have. It is very important to be truthful when listing your items as it can make or break your business. Buyers and sellers alike are able to leave feedback that is visible to the entire eBay community. The goal is to retain the most positive feedback possible. Your future buyers will be reading up on you before deciding to make a purchase and it can be the difference between a purchase or a pass.
You may also want to use a drop shipping company. A dropshipper is a wholesale supplier who sends products to your customers directly. When your customers purchase an item, they will pay full retail price. You would then purchase the item from the dropshipper at a lower wholesale price. This means that you will not have to store or house any inventory or worry about any shipping issues. You profit the difference. It is difficult to find legitimate dropshippers with quality products. Now that you have chosen your items, list list list! The listing process is very simple and straightforward. You are guided through every step of the way with easy to follow instructions. Type in your descriptive title, fill out any necessary information pertaining to your specific item, and upload a few pictures. Next, there is a text box available for you to fully describe your item. Tell buyers what you have for sale and get them interested! You can add features to make your listing stand out, such as a colorful background, bold title text, multiple photo upload, and higlighted listing options. The extras add to your total listing cost, but all fees are explained before you commit to sell and it really isn't much in comparison to what you will gain when your items is sold.
Now you set your starting bid price, buy it now price, select the quantity, and the duration of your listing (how many days you want your item to stay live online for bids). The buy it now price is optional, and is a way for buyers to purchase your item without going through the auction for a fixed price. This is a price that is set by you, the seller, and will allow the ending of the auction early if someone decides to purchase. Continue by selecting the payment methods you are willing to accept, the shipping price you will charge, and the locations you are willing to sell/ship to. There is also a section towards the bottom that has sales tax, a return policy, and an "additional comments" box, all of which are optional. Once you continue, choose all of the bells and whistles and you are set to go! Keep track of your item in "My eBay", which is also fairly easy to navigate.
When your auction ends, wait for the buyer to make a payment. Be patient, sometimes it takes a couple of days. Get your item ready for shipping. Once the payment has cleared, send off your item. Be sure to mail it off in a timely manner so your customer remains satisfied with their purchase.
